IFC plans to double down on India investments in next 5 years: Makhtar Diop, MD

Published on: Sept. 15, 2025, 5:30 a.m. | Source: The Economic Times

The International Finance Corporation (IFC) intends to double its annual investments in India to $10 billion by 2030, emphasizing urbanization, green energy, and MSMEs. IFC's commitment of $5.4 billion in FY25 signals its dedication to India's resilient private sector. The World Bank projects a modest global expansion of 2.3% in 2025.
